Description

Technical Field

[0001] The invention relates to the field of cleaning tools, in particular to a cleaning brush and a cleaning system. Background Art

[0002] Conventional water-powered car wash brushes, such as those in high-pressure washers, use water to propel the brushes in rotation, thereby polishing and cleaning the car's surface. Currently, portable car washers are powered by lithium batteries. Due to the energy limitations of lithium batteries, the water pressure and flow rate in most car washers are relatively low, making them unable to drive traditional brushes. If these car wash brushes are used in battery-powered washers, the brushes may not rotate due to insufficient power or insufficient rotation speed, resulting in ineffective cleaning. Therefore, there is an urgent need to develop a new cleaning brush, cleaning device, and cleaning apparatus. Summary of the Invention

[0041] See also Figures 1 to 4 The present invention provides a cleaning brush, which can improve the cleaning efficiency by scrubbing an auxiliary brush, and can also be installed on a high-pressure cleaning machine as a cleaning accessory, which can effectively improve the problem that the speed of the existing cleaning brush is limited by the water flow rate, resulting in insufficient speed and poor cleaning effect.

[0042] See also Figure 1 and Figure 2The cleaning brush comprises: a brush handle 100, a power assembly 200, a first brush 300 and an energy assembly 400. The structure of the brush handle 100 is not limited, and includes but is not limited to a shell with a hollow chamber or a solid rod-shaped structure. In one example of the present invention, the brush handle 100 is a shell made of plastic material, and a accommodating chamber 110 is provided in the shell. An interface 102 is provided at one end of the accommodating chamber 110, through which a fluid with power can be received, such as a tap water pipe, a fluid pumped in by a suction device, or a cleaning liquid sprayed from a high-pressure cleaner; the housing of the power assembly 200 is installed in the accommodating chamber 110. The power assembly 200 may include only a motor 210, or may include a motor 210 and a reducer 220, or a combination of the motor 210 and other transmission structures. In this example, the power assembly 200 adopts a combination of a motor 210 and a reducer 220. The first brush 300 is disposed outside the housing of the brush handle 100 and is driven to rotate by the power assembly 200. A spray hole 320 is provided on the first brush 300. The spray hole 320 is fluidically connected to the interface 102 via a pipe 700 or channel. Preferably, the water outlet direction of the pipe or channel intersects the output axis of the power assembly 200. The structure and shape of the first brush 300 are not limited and can, for example, be square, star-shaped, elliptical, or any other suitable shape. The energy assembly 400 is mounted on the brush handle 100 and provides power to the power assembly 200. It should be noted that the energy assembly 400 in the present invention can be a battery pack or a fuel or gas power generation device, capable of providing sufficient power to the power assembly 200.

[0043] See also Figure 1 and Figure 2In the present invention, the first brush 300 can be mounted on the output shaft 221 in any suitable manner that can secure the first brush 300 to the output shaft 221 and connect the cleaning liquid flowing into the interface 102 to the spray hole 320. In one example of a cleaning brush according to the present invention, the first brush 300 is connected to the output shaft 221 of the power assembly 200 via a joint assembly 600, and the output axis of the power assembly 200 is coaxial with the rotation axis of the first brush 300. The joint assembly 600 drives the first brush 300 to rotate while simultaneously achieving communication between the interface 102 and the spray hole 320. The joint assembly 600 includes a base 610 and a rotating body 620. The base 610 can be secured within the accommodating cavity 110 of the brush handle 100, or secured to the housing of the power assembly 200, or simply mounted on the output shaft 221 of the power assembly 200 without being connected to the housing of the power assembly 200 or the accommodating cavity 110. A liquid inlet 614 is provided on the outer wall of the base body 610, and the liquid inlet 614 is connected to the interface 102 through a pipe 700; the rotating body 620 can be rotatably installed on the base body 610, one end of the rotating body 620 is connected to the output shaft 221, and the other end of the rotating body 620 is connected to the first brush 300; a flow channel is provided in the rotating body 620, and during the rotation of the rotating body 620, the flow channel is always connected to the liquid inlet 614 and the spray hole 320.

[0044] See also Figure 2In one example of the cleaning brush of the present invention, the base 610 includes an outer sleeve 611 and a core tube 612. The outer sleeve 611 is provided with a first through hole (not shown), which extends in the same direction as the output shaft 221. The outer wall shape and size of the core tube 612 match the shape and size of the first through hole. The core tube 612 is inserted into the first through hole. Considering that there is no relative motion between the outer sleeve 611 and the core tube 612 during normal operation, the shape of the first through hole is not limited, including but not limited to square, circular, star-shaped, elliptical, etc. The core tube 612 is provided with a second through hole (not shown), which also extends in the same direction as the output shaft 221. The outer wall shape and size of the rotating body 620 match the shape and size of the second through hole. Considering that there is rotational relative motion between the core tube 612 and the rotating body 620, the shape of the second through hole is circular or other suitable rotating body contour. The rotating body 620 is installed in the second through hole and rotates relative to the core tube 612. A dynamic seal assembly 623 is provided between the rotating body 620 and the core tube 612. The dynamic seal assembly 623 can be any suitable dynamic seal assembly 623 suitable for rotary sealing, such as a skeleton oil seal, a packing seal, etc. In one embodiment of the present invention, the dynamic seal assembly 623 includes at least two sets of packing seal assemblies. The at least two sets of packing seal assemblies are provided on the contact surface between the rotating body 620 and the core tube 612, and are respectively provided on both sides of the liquid inlet 614 to prevent the cleaning liquid in the liquid inlet 614 from leaking from the mating surfaces of the rotating body 620 and the core tube 612 on both sides.

[0045] See also Figure 2 In one example of the cleaning brush of the present invention, a boss 625 is provided on the rotating body 620 to mate with the end of the core tube 612. A first washer 630 is disposed between the end surface of the core tube 612 and the boss 625. A connector 650 is mounted on the end of the rotating body 620 facing the first brush 300. A second washer 640 is disposed between the connector 650 and the end surface of the core tube 612. The first washer 630 and the second washer 640 are made of a wear-resistant material, and the hardness of the first washer 630 and the second washer 640 is preferably less than that of the rotating body 620 and the core tube 612. This reduces wear on the core tube 612 and the rotating body 620 during their relative rotation.

[0046] See also Figure 2In the present invention, if the outer sleeve 611 and the core tube 612 are bonded or interference fit, the static sealing component 613 may not be provided. However, in order to have a better sealing effect, in an example of the cleaning brush of the present invention, a static sealing component 613 is provided between the outer sleeve 611 and the core tube 612. The static sealing component 613 can be any suitable sealing component suitable for static sealing, such as an O-ring, a sealing gasket, etc. In an example of the present invention, the static sealing component 613 includes at least two O-rings, and at least two O-rings are provided on the contact surface of the outer sleeve 611 and the core tube 612, and are respectively provided on both sides of the liquid inlet 614 to prevent the cleaning liquid in the liquid inlet 614 from leaking from the matching surfaces of the outer sleeve 611 and the core tube 612 on both sides.

[0047] See also Figure 2 To maintain a stable flow rate from the spray hole 320, in one example of the cleaning brush of the present invention, a first liquid storage chamber 624 is provided between the rotating body 620 and the core tube 612. The first liquid storage chamber 624 is disposed around the outer wall of the rotating body 620. The outer wall of the first liquid storage chamber 624 communicates with the liquid inlet 614, and the inner wall of the first liquid storage chamber 624 communicates with the flow channel within the rotating body 620. The flow channel is disposed on the rotating body 620 and includes an axial extension section 621 and a radial extension section 622. One end of the axial extension section 621 communicates with the spray hole 320, and the other end of the axial extension section 621 communicates with the radial extension section 622. The outer side of the radial extension section 622 remains in communication with the first liquid storage chamber 624 during the rotation of the rotating body 620. During the rotation of the rotating body 620, the opening of the flow channel remains in communication with the first liquid storage chamber 624, thereby ensuring a stable flow rate of cleaning liquid within the flow channel. It should be noted that the setting form of the first liquid storage chamber 624 between the rotating body 620 and the core tube 612 is not limited. For example, it can be a combination of the inner wall of the core tube 612 and the groove set on the outer wall of the rotating body 620, or it can be a combination of the outer wall of the rotating body 620 and the groove set on the inner wall of the core tube 612, or as in this example, a combination of the groove set on the outer wall of the rotating body 620 and the groove on the inner wall of the core tube 612.

[0048] See also Figure 2Taking into account the centrifugal force caused by rotation, in one example of the present invention, a second liquid storage chamber 615 is provided between the outer sleeve 611 and the core tube 612. The second liquid storage chamber 615 is arranged around the outside of the first liquid storage chamber 624. At least one connecting hole 6121 is provided between the first liquid storage chamber 624 and the second liquid storage chamber 615. The outer side of the second liquid storage chamber 615 is connected to the liquid inlet 614, and the inner side of the second liquid storage chamber 615 is connected to the first liquid storage chamber 624 through the at least one connecting hole 6121. It should be noted that the arrangement of the second liquid storage chamber 615 between the outer sleeve 611 and the core tube 612 is not limited. For example, it can be a combination of the outer wall of the core tube 612 and a groove provided on the inner wall of the outer sleeve 611, or a combination of a groove provided on the outer wall of the rotating body 620 and a groove provided on the inner wall of the core tube 612, or a combination of the inner wall of the outer sleeve 611 and a groove provided on the outer wall of the core tube 612 as in this example.

[0049] See also Figure 2 The first liquid storage chamber 624 and the second liquid storage chamber 615 of the cleaning brush of the present invention are arranged in an annular manner and connected through the connecting hole 6121. On the one hand, during the rotation of the rotating body 620, the partition wall between the first liquid storage chamber 624 and the second liquid storage chamber 615 can weaken the centrifugal force of the cleaning liquid in the first liquid storage chamber 624 caused by the rotation of the rotating body 620. On the other hand, the communication between the first liquid storage chamber 624 and the second liquid storage chamber 615 can be ensured through the connecting hole 6121, thereby fully ensuring the stability of water outflow from the spray hole 320.

[0050] See also Figure 2 In the present invention, the connection method between the first brush 300 and the joint assembly 600 can be any suitable method that can achieve a sealed connection. Taking into account the need for interchangeability and replacement, in one example of the cleaning brush of the present invention, the first brush 300 and the joint assembly 600 are detachably connected, and the cleaning brush also includes a second brush that is interchangeable with the first brush 300. The second brush can be the same as the first brush, or different from the first brush, as long as the connection part structure is the same and can be interchangeably installed on the connector 650. In one example of the present invention, the connector 650 is a quick-connect connector installed on the rotating body 620. The installation method between the quick-connect connector and the rotating body 620 includes but is not limited to welding, bonding and threaded connection. In one example of the present invention, the quick-connect connector is threadedly connected to the rotating body 620, and the first brush 300 and the joint assembly 600 are connected via a quick-connect connector. It should be noted that the quick-connect connector can be a standard quick-connect connector commonly used in the hydraulic field or pipeline connection field, which will not be described in detail here.

[0051] See also Figures 2 to 4Considering the uniformity of the cleaning liquid spraying, in an example of the cleaning brush of the present invention, the spray hole 320 is coaxially arranged with the output shaft 221. The first brush 300 is a disc brush, which includes a disc body 310 and at least one circle of bristles 330 arranged around the spray hole 320. The shape of the disc 310 includes, but is not limited to, a disc, a rectangle, or a square. Preferably, considering the dynamic balance of the rotating body 620, in one example of the cleaning brush of the present invention, the disc 310 is disc-shaped. The bristles 330 can be arranged in a variety of ways, as long as a contour surrounding the spray hole 320 is formed. For example, the bristles 330 can be arranged in a spiral pattern on the disc 310, with the spray hole 320 located at the center of the spiral. In this arrangement, when the cleaning liquid is ejected from the spray hole 320 and radially ejected, it is intercepted by the bristles 330, effectively conserving cleaning liquid. When the cleaning liquid is not merely water, for example, but contains a foaming component such as detergent, in one example of the cleaning brush of the present invention, the first brush 300 includes multiple annular rings of bristles 330, which are arranged concentrically with the spray hole 320. This arrangement not only disperses the cleaning liquid more evenly under the action of centrifugal force, resulting in better foam, but also conserves water and detergent.

[0052] However, in another example of the cleaning brush of the present invention, the second brush is a roller brush, which includes a roller and bristles installed on the cylindrical surface of the roller. The inner cavity of the roller is closed and connected to the spray hole, and a plurality of small holes are provided on the wall of the roller to allow the cleaning agent to leak to the side of the bristles.

[0053] See also Figure 1 Taking into account the environmental friendliness of energy, in an example of the cleaning brush of the present invention, the energy component 400 is installed between the power component and the gripping portion and closer to the power component. Such an installation position is more ergonomic and can increase the operating comfort of the operator. The energy component 400 includes a rechargeable battery pack and an indicator light 500. The rechargeable battery pack is detachably mounted on the brush handle 100. The brush handle 100 is provided with a Type C charging port 101 for charging the battery pack, and the battery pack can be charged according to the power level. In an example of the cleaning brush of the present invention, the cleaning brush also includes an indicator light 500 and a switch. The indicator light 500 is exposed outside the brush handle 100 and is used to display the battery power status. The switch is provided on the gripping portion of the brush handle 100 and can turn the cleaning brush on or off.

[0054] Considering the need for automated control, in one example of the cleaning brush of the present invention, the cleaning brush further includes a controller (not shown), which is electrically connected to the power assembly 200 and the energy assembly 400. The controller can be used to set different speed modes, such as high speed, medium speed, low speed, or forward and reverse rotation, to provide targeted cleaning for different stains and objects to be cleaned.

[0055] See also Figure 1 For ease of use, in one example of the cleaning brush of the present invention, the brush handle 100 extends in an arm-like configuration with a bend at one end. The first brush 300 is mounted on the bend, and the interface 102 is located at the other end of the brush handle 100. The portion of the brush handle 100 near the interface 102 forms the grip, with the longitudinal axis of the grip intersecting the output axis of the power assembly 200. This arrangement is both convenient for operation and ergonomically sound. The arm-like extension makes it easier to reach distant stains, and the bend facilitates application of force to the surface being cleaned.
